Understanding Barrel Materials and Their Threadability

The success of threading a non-threaded barrel hinges heavily on the material the barrel is made from. Different metals possess varying levels of machinability and hardness, directly impacting the feasibility and difficulty of the threading process.

Common Barrel Materials and Their Suitability

Material Machinability Threadability Considerations
Steel Good Good Requires appropriate cutting tools and lubricants.
Stainless Steel Moderate Moderate More resistant to cutting, requires specialized tools.
Aluminum Excellent Excellent Relatively easy to thread, but less durable.
Brass Excellent Excellent Soft, easy to thread, but prone to wear.
Titanium Poor Poor Extremely difficult and requires specialized expertise.

Steel is a popular choice for firearm barrels due to its strength and durability. Threading steel barrels is achievable with the right equipment and expertise. Stainless steel, while harder, can still be threaded, but the process requires more care and specialized tools designed for harder materials. Aluminum is the easiest to work with but might not be suitable for high-pressure applications. Titanium is exceptionally difficult to thread due to its high strength and low machinability, requiring specialized and expensive equipment.

The Process of Threading a Non-Threaded Barrel: A Step-by-Step Guide

Threading a barrel is a precision operation that requires specialized tools and a high level of skill. Attempting this without proper experience can lead to damaged equipment and even injury.

1. Preparation is Key: Before starting, ensure you have the correct tools, including a lathe, die set specific to the desired thread type and barrel material, cutting oil or lubricant, and appropriate safety gear (eye protection, gloves, etc.). Precise measurements of the barrel's diameter are crucial for selecting the correct die.

2. Securing the Barrel: The barrel must be securely clamped in a lathe to ensure stability and prevent movement during the threading process. Improper clamping can lead to inaccurate threads or even barrel damage.

3. Initial Cutting: Start with a light cut, gradually increasing the depth with each pass. Using sufficient cutting fluid is essential to prevent overheating and tool wear. This step requires patience and precision; rushing can ruin the barrel.

4. Checking Thread Accuracy: Regularly inspect the threads using thread gauges to ensure accuracy and consistency. Corrections may be needed, but significant errors might necessitate starting over.

5. Finishing Touches: Once the threads are complete, carefully deburr and clean them to remove any sharp edges or debris. This step is important for smooth operation and preventing potential damage to other components.

6. Testing: Before assembling the threaded barrel into its intended application, it is imperative to thoroughly test the threads for proper fit and functionality.

Tools Required for Threading a Barrel:

  • Lathe: A precision lathe is essential for holding and rotating the barrel accurately.
  • Die Set: A die set matching the desired thread type and pitch is crucial. This will vary depending on the barrel and its intended use.
  • Cutting Fluid/Lubricant: This is vital to prevent overheating and maintain tool life.
  • Thread Gauges: These tools check the accuracy of the threads throughout the process.
  • Deburring Tools: These tools smooth out any rough edges or imperfections on the threads.
  • Measuring Instruments: Calipers and micrometers are needed for accurate measurements.

Safety Precautions: Working with Machinery and Sharp Objects

Working with a lathe and cutting tools presents inherent risks. Always prioritize safety:

  • Eye Protection: Wear safety glasses or a face shield at all times.
  • Gloves: Protective gloves prevent cuts and abrasions.
  • Proper Clothing: Wear clothing that won’t get caught in the machinery.
  • Clear Workspace: Keep the area around the lathe clear of obstructions.
  • Emergency Stop: Know the location and operation of the lathe's emergency stop.
  • Training: If you are unfamiliar with lathe operation, seek professional instruction before attempting to thread a barrel.

Is it Worth It? Weighing the Costs and Benefits

The decision to thread a non-threaded barrel should involve a careful cost-benefit analysis. Consider the cost of tools, materials, and potential labor (if hiring a professional), compared to purchasing a pre-threaded barrel. Consider the risks involved. If you lack the necessary skills or equipment, the cost of mistakes could outweigh the savings.

Conclusion: A Skillful and Risky Undertaking

Threading a non-threaded barrel is achievable but demands specialized skills, equipment, and a meticulous approach. While potentially cost-effective for some individuals with the necessary expertise, it’s crucial to weigh the risks and costs against the alternative of using a pre-threaded barrel. Safety should always be the top priority. If you're unsure, consulting with a professional machinist is highly recommended. Improperly threaded barrels can be unsafe and lead to serious consequences.
